Comprar
Buy
Language note: Same verb; in a plan: “Vamos comprar…” = “Let’s buy…”.
Culture note: If you hear “Vamos ali comprar…”, it means “Let’s go over there to buy…”, very conversational.
Context: You indicate the action you’re about to do: buy.
Word-by-Word Breakdown
Comprar
[kom-PRAR]
To buy
Infinitive verb used for purchasing things, like train tickets (bilhetes) online or at the station.
Quero comprar um bilhete de ida e volta Porto–Lisboa.
I want to buy a round-trip ticket Porto–Lisbon.
